Tiger Packs Peanut Butter Drive

Tiger Packs is an initiative of the Greater Poweshiek Community Foundation (GPCF) that was established to combat hunger in the Grinnell-Newburg School District. We are launching a peanut butter drive this holiday season as part of a greater effort to raise awareness for child hunger in Grinnell. Poweshiek County Alliance Awards $97,260 to Local Organizations

The Poweshiek County Alliance (PCA) honored its 2014 grant recipients at a ceremony at the Foundation Offices on Tuesday, March 25, 2014. Representatives from the 35 winning organizations received their checks and spoke about their projects. 2015 Spirit of Giving Nominations Are Being Accepted

The Greater Poweshiek Community Foundation is now accepting nominations for its annual Connie Marshall Spirit of Giving Award. Nominations are due by August 31, 2015. The winner will be announced at the annual Spirit of Giving reception on October 12, 2015. GPCF Community Fund Grants Awarded

At a grant ceremony held at the Foundation Offices in Grinnell on July 6, 2015, Tim Douglas, President of the GPCF board, presented 10 awards to nonprofits and public entities throughout Poweshiek County.
